Regulations for THC Drinks

Missouri's budding cannabis industry is experiencing explosive growth, and with it comes a new frontier: THC-infused beverages. While the concept of cannabis cocktails is gaining popularity, crafting effective regulations for these potent potions poses a significant dilemma.

One key focus is consumer well-being. Given the inherent variability in THC absorption rates through ingestion compared to smoking or vaping, establishing clear dosage guidelines and labeling requirements is vital to prevent accidental overconsumption.

Moreover, regulators must address issues like product quality control, ensuring that these beverages are created responsibly and meet stringent safety standards.

The goal is to create a regulatory framework that allows for innovation in the cannabis beverage sector while promising consumer well-being.

The Gateway City's Lawmakers Tackle the THC Beverage Boom

St. Louis lawmakers are grappling with a wave in hemp-derived beverages, sparking debate over regulation. Proponents posit that these drinks offer a enjoyable alternative to traditional consumption methods, while naysayers voice concerns about potential safety risks and the likelihood of misuse. City officials are ongoing considering a range of solutions, including new legislation to address the growing market.

  • Some lawmakers are calling for mandatory labeling requirements on THC beverages.
  • Furthermore, some are advocating higher age limits and designated retail outlets.
The discussion is bound to intensify as St. Louis deals with the challenges of this shifting industry landscape.
